Online Class Availability at College of the Canyons
Distance learning is available at College of the Canyons. Among 18,075 students, 5,786 (32%) studied exclusively online and 5,845 (32%) took at least some classes online.

Business Support & Assistance Associate’s Program at College of the Canyons
Among the 9 associate’s business support & assistance graduates at College of the Canyons, 89% were women (8) and 11% were men (1).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Business Support & Assistance associate’s degree recipients at College of the Canyons.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 4 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 5 |
Minority students account for 56% of Business Support & Assistance associate’s degree recipients at College of the Canyons, above the national average of 48%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
